Numbers 20:21

Edom refused to give Israel passage through his border, etc.—A churlish refusal obliged them to take another route. (See on Numbers 21:4; Deuteronomy 2:4; and Judges 11:18; see also I Samuel 14:47; II Samuel 8:14, which describe the retribution that was taken.)
